私は、ファイルからの計算にデータを読み取ることができますどのように

J

J_expoler2

Guest
EX iコマンドを使用しているファイルをex aa.txt / / 10.7939453125 5.7196457736 1.6390841007 1.4315398899 1.6162836208 / /からのデータ; fscanfは(FP、 "%d個の%d個"、&D1、&D2); iはプロセスにデータを使用したいが、ファイルから読み込んだデータは私はプログラミング(C + +)をどのように間違って感謝
 
ここでのfscanfコマンドの例を確認してください: http://www.cplusplus.com/ref/cstdio/fscanf.html %dは恐らく、整数型の変数に読み込みません​​あなたが何をしたいか何。 ..あなたのコンパイラがこのことについて警告を発しません?宜しく
 
char型の配列にデータを読み込み、それを上intergersを形成するために変換する
 
こんにちは、このコードスニペットを試して、それが動作するはずです。FILE * F;ダブルDTMP、フロートftmp、((F =のfopen( "aa.txt"、 "R"))== NULL)の場合{/ /入力ファイルを開くことができません戻り値;};中(!FEOF(F))/ /ファイルの終わりではないながら、{fscanfは(F、 "%lfをしました\ n"、&DTMP)/ /この行は変数の型 "二重" / /関数fscanf(F用です、 "%fをしました\ n"、&ftmp)/ /この行は、変数の型の "float"}のためである; fcloseを(F)は、
 
あなたが言うのですかどのようにこれは私がどのようにファイルに入れないform30.text1(整数)form30.text2(文字列)などを置きたいと言う..そしてどのようにそれらを取り戻すであろう..私はまだそれで少し混乱している原因。とにかくそれは私がCROMの土地を作ってるんだゲーム内でロード/セーブのようなもののためだ。感謝
 

Welcome to EDABoard.com

Sponsor

Back
Top